Energy storage system 12 -24 kVA f EES D 12/12 ENDRESS energy storage system Model EES D 12/12 EES D 20/20 EES D 24/24 Order No. 610 014 610 015 610 016 Technical specifications Power section Continuous output at 25°C kVA/kW 10.5 15 21 Power (1) at 25°C kVA/kW 12 18 24 Peak power (2) at 25°C kVA/kW 31.5 45 63 Rated voltage 400 / 230 V 400 / 230 V 400 / 230 V Nominal output current in independent operation 17 A 26 A 35 A Nominal output current in combined 32 A operation 63 A 63 A Protection Class IP 54 IP 54 IP 54 Protective measures RCD (residual-current-operated protective device) RCD (residual-current-operated protective device) RCD (residual-current-operated protective device) Design according to DGUV 203-032 B B (Protective separation with residual- (Protective separation with residualcurrent operated protective device) current operated protective device) B (Protective separation with residualcurrent operated protective device) Rated capacity 12 kWh 20 kWh 24 kWh Rated nominal capacity (optionally available) 16, 20, 24 kWh 24 kWh – Battery cycles 1400 1400 1400 Operating temperature range -20°C – 55°C -20°C – 55°C -20°C – 55°C Charging time, approx. 2.5 h 2.5 h 2.5 h Energy storage system Battery system Assembly Weight approx. 800 kg 1300 kg 1500 kg Dimensions L x W x H 1200 x 800 x 1700 mm 1200 x 800 x 1700 mm 1200 x 800 x 1700 mm Input sockets 1x CEE 400 V / 32A 1x 230 V / 16A device plug 1x CEE 400 V / 63A 1x 230 V / 16A device plug 1x CEE 400 V / 63A 1x 230 V / 16A device plug sockets 1x 230 V / 16 A (3) 1x CEE 400 V / 16 A 1x CEE 400 V / 32 A 1x 230 V / 16 A (3) 1x CEE 400 V / 16 A 1x CEE 400 V / 32 A 1x CEE 400 V / 63 A 1x 230 V / 16 A (3) 1x CEE 400 V / 16 A 1x CEE 400 V / 32 A 1x CEE 400 V / 63 A Monitoring LCD display AC voltage, AC current for each AC voltage, AC current for each AC voltage, AC current for each phase, phase, battery capacity, discharging phase, battery capacity, discharging battery capacity, discharging current, current, charging current current, charging current charging current Remote start input 2 conductors Options Remote monitoring Timer function for energy saving system Timer function for the remote starting of a generator Socket with load shedding of secondary consumers (1) approx. 30 min. (2) approx. 3 sec. (2) Socket also used for maintaining the battery charge Ideal for: Tunnel and nigh construction sites, events, power supply for residential containers, tools and electrical equipment. 56 Recharging time: approx. 2.5 h (recharging time varies as it depends on the recharging method) 2 conductors 2 conductors Version C according to DGUV Information 203-032 as an IT system with residual current protection device (includes an earthing stake) and insulation monitoring with status signalling Version C according to DGUV Information 203-032 as an IT system with residual current protection device (includes an earthing stake) Insulation monitoring with IT system switching off or Version B as per DGUV Information 203-032 Ecological: No CO2 emissions, reduced noise emissions Economical: Lower generator running times for less fuel consumption, an optimised generator utilisation rate for lower signs of wear Safety: Overload, over-temperature and short-circuit protection, deep-discharge protection
